Abstract
⺠The organisation of four neural systems is described in the brains of three Afrotherians not previously studied. ⺠These systems are organised in a similar manner to other mammals. ⺠There are features that reflect both phylogenetic and functional signals in the evolution of these neural systems. ⺠The golden mole appears to be a “hyper-cholinergic” mammal, possessing cholinergic neurons in novel regions of the brain.
